Nomura Securities on Gaming & Lodging Stocks: Macau May Gaming Revenues Should Set Record
Analyst, Harry C. Curtis, said, "The first 13 days of May gaming revenues imply ~MOP28bn for the month vs. our estimate of MOP29bn (up ~19% YoY). Whether the month comes in at MOP28b or MOP29b, it will be a new monthly record."
"We characterize overall demand since the opening of Sands Cotai as strong but not above expectations. This result should not be unexpected, as Sands Cotai’s VIP tables (~150 tables) will not be fully operational until the end of May."
"As for the stocks, we think they should continue to consolidate after outperforming strongly year to date. However, we continue to believe that Las Vegas Sands (NYSE: LVS), Wynn Resorts (Nasdaq: WYNN) and MGM (NYSE: MGM) should be bought, in particular accumulated on weakness, given strong free cash flow yields. In the coming 12 months, we think free cash flow should increase as demand growth in Macau outpaces supply growth by a wide margin."
